<p><i>Galanthus subalpinus</i> (Amaryllidaceae), a new snowdrop species endemic to the Western Balkans (North Macedonia and Kosovo) is described and illustrated. Morphological differences between the new species and the similar <i>Galanthus</i> species, <i>G. nivalis</i> and <i>G. graecus</i>, are reported and discussed, in combination with DNA sequence data from plastid (<i>trn</i>L-<i>trn</i>F, <i>mat</i>K) and nuclear (ribosomal ITS) markers and genome size. Line drawings, photographs of habitat and morphology, a distribution map and a preliminary conservation assessment are provided. The genome size (1C-value) of <i>G. bursanus</i>, <i>G. samothracicus</i> and <i>G.</i> × <i>valentinei</i> nothosubsp. <i>subplicatus</i> are reported for the first time<i>.</i></p>
